Structured explanations enhance credibility.<\/p>\n<hr \/>\n<h2><b>Editing the Methods Chapter in Computational Biology<\/b><\/h2>\n<p class=\"p3\">The methods chapter remains one of the most scrutinised sections in a Biomedical Sciences PhD. Examiners assess reproducibility and transparency carefully.<\/p>\n<p class=\"p3\">A thesis editor evaluates whether:<\/p>\n<p class=\"p3\">Software versions are specified<\/p>\n<p class=\"p3\">Databases are clearly cited<\/p>\n<p class=\"p3\">Parameter thresholds are justified<\/p>\n<p class=\"p3\">Statistical tests are explained<\/p>\n<p class=\"p3\">Limitations are acknowledged<\/p>\n<p class=\"p3\">Transparent reporting aligns with international research standards, including guidelines outlined by organisations such as the <a href=\"https:\/\/www.ukri.org\/\">UK Research and Innovation biomedical funding guidance<\/a>.<\/p>\n<p class=\"p3\">While your data drive the research, presentation determines how confidently examiners interpret it.<\/p>\n<hr \/>\n<h2><b>Refining Data Analysis Sections<\/b><\/h2>\n<p class=\"p3\">Bioinformatics theses often include high-throughput sequencing data, gene expression analysis, variant calling pipelines, or structural modelling outputs.<\/p>\n<p class=\"p3\">Common issues in data chapters include:<\/p>\n<p class=\"p3\">Overloaded tables without interpretation<\/p>\n<p class=\"p3\">Repetition of figure descriptions<\/p>\n<p class=\"p3\">Insufficient linkage between results and hypothesis<\/p>\n<p class=\"p3\">Unclear statistical reporting<\/p>\n<p class=\"p3\">A professional thesis editor ensures that results move beyond description toward analytical interpretation.<\/p>\n<p class=\"p3\">Each figure should serve a purpose, and each table should advance argument, and also, each statistical value should connect to the research question.<\/p>\n<hr \/>\n<h2><b>Structuring Results for Maximum Impact<\/b><\/h2>\n<p class=\"p3\">Computational biology research generates substantial outputs. Without careful structure, readers may struggle to follow the narrative.<\/p>\n<p class=\"p3\">Effective editing reorganises content to ensure:<\/p>\n<p class=\"p3\">Chronological workflow progression<\/p>\n<p class=\"p3\">Logical grouping of experiments<\/p>\n<p class=\"p3\">Clear subheadings<\/p>\n<p class=\"p3\">Strategic placement of figures<\/p>\n<p class=\"p3\">Smooth transitions between subsections<\/p>\n<p class=\"p3\">Strong structure enhances coherence.<\/p>\n<hr \/>\n<h2><b>Editing Statistical Interpretation in Biomedical Sciences<\/b><\/h2>\n<p class=\"p3\">Bioinformatics research often relies on p-values, confidence intervals, regression models, clustering algorithms, and predictive modelling metrics.<\/p>\n<p class=\"p3\">Editors verify:<\/p>\n<p class=\"p3\">Accurate statistical terminology<\/p>\n<p class=\"p3\">Correct description of tests<\/p>\n<p class=\"p3\">Consistency between text and tables<\/p>\n<p class=\"p3\">Clear explanation of assumptions<\/p>\n<p class=\"p3\">Proper interpretation of significance<\/p>\n<p class=\"p3\">Statistical accuracy strengthens scientific authority.<\/p>\n<hr \/>\n<h2><b>Integrating Computational and Biological Insight<\/b><\/h2>\n<p class=\"p3\">One common weakness in bioinformatics theses arises when computational findings appear disconnected from biological relevance.<\/p>\n<p class=\"p3\">A thesis editor evaluates whether biological interpretation follows algorithmic output. Data analysis must translate into meaningful biomedical insight.<\/p>\n<p class=\"p3\">For example, differential gene expression results should connect to known pathways or phenotypic implications. Similarly, predictive modelling should link back to disease mechanisms.<\/p>\n<p class=\"p3\">Integration strengthens the thesis narrative.<\/p>\n<hr \/>\n<h2><b>Literature Review Editing in Computational Biology<\/b><\/h2>\n<p class=\"p3\">A Biomedical Sciences PhD must situate computational methods within existing scholarship.<\/p>\n<p class=\"p3\">Editors assess whether:<\/p>\n<p class=\"p3\">Key bioinformatics tools are contextualised<\/p>\n<p class=\"p3\">Recent developments are included<\/p>\n<p class=\"p3\">Competing models are evaluated<\/p>\n<p class=\"p3\">Methodological debates are acknowledged<\/p>\n<p class=\"p3\">Strong literature synthesis demonstrates academic maturity.<\/p>\n<p class=\"p3\">The importance of theoretical clarity in doctoral writing, even across disciplines, parallels principles discussed in advanced research contexts such as <a href=\"https:\/\/british-proofreading.co.uk\/blog\/thesis-editing-uk-psychology-phd-theoretical-precision\/\">theoretical precision in PhD scholarship<\/a>.<\/p>\n<p class=\"p3\">Clear conceptual framing strengthens argument.<\/p>\n<hr \/>\n<h2><b>Addressing Ethical and Data Governance Considerations<\/b><\/h2>\n<p class=\"p3\">Biomedical research often involves human genomic data or sensitive datasets.<\/p>\n<p class=\"p3\">Editors review whether:<\/p>\n<p class=\"p3\">Ethical approvals are stated<\/p>\n<p class=\"p3\">Data anonymisation is explained<\/p>\n<p class=\"p3\">Consent procedures are mentioned<\/p>\n<p class=\"p3\">Regulatory compliance is clear<\/p>\n<p class=\"p3\">Transparent ethical reporting enhances credibility.<\/p>\n<hr \/>\n<h2><b>Ensuring Consistency in Terminology<\/b><\/h2>\n<p class=\"p3\">Bioinformatics theses frequently shift between abbreviations and technical terms.<\/p>\n<p class=\"p3\">Editors ensure that:<\/p>\n<p class=\"p3\">Gene names follow standard conventions<\/p>\n<p class=\"p3\">Statistical notation remains consistent<\/p>\n<p class=\"p3\">Software tools are referenced uniformly<\/p>\n<p class=\"p3\">Units of measurement align throughout<\/p>\n<p class=\"p3\">Consistency reduces confusion.<\/p>\n<hr \/>\n<h2><b>Enhancing Clarity in Machine Learning Chapters<\/b><\/h2>\n<p class=\"p3\">Many computational biology theses incorporate machine learning or artificial intelligence approaches.<\/p>\n<p class=\"p3\">Editing strengthens:<\/p>\n<p class=\"p3\">Clear explanation of model architecture<\/p>\n<p class=\"p3\">Description of training and validation sets<\/p>\n<p class=\"p3\">Performance metrics interpretation<\/p>\n<p class=\"p3\">Discussion of overfitting<\/p>\n<p class=\"p3\">Comparison to baseline models<\/p>\n<p class=\"p3\">Machine learning sections must remain accessible to biomedical examiners who may not specialise in computer science.<\/p>\n<p class=\"p3\">Clarity bridges disciplinary boundaries.<\/p>\n<hr \/>\n<h2><b>Editing Discussion Chapters for Scientific Coherence<\/b><\/h2>\n<p class=\"p3\">The discussion chapter synthesises computational findings with broader biomedical implications.<\/p>\n<p class=\"p3\">Editors refine:<\/p>\n<p class=\"p3\">Logical progression of argument<\/p>\n<p class=\"p3\">Balanced acknowledgement of limitations<\/p>\n<p class=\"p3\">Clear articulation of novelty<\/p>\n<p class=\"p3\">Avoidance of overstatement<\/p>\n<p class=\"p3\">Connection to future research<\/p>\n<p class=\"p3\">Strong discussion sections demonstrate doctoral independence.<\/p>\n<hr \/>\n<h2><b>Common Examiner Critiques in Bioinformatics PhDs<\/b><\/h2>\n<p class=\"p3\">Examiners frequently comment on:<\/p>\n<p class=\"p3\">Unclear workflow explanations<\/p>\n<p class=\"p3\">Insufficient justification of computational choices<\/p>\n<p class=\"p3\">Overemphasis on software output<\/p>\n<p class=\"p3\">Underdeveloped biological interpretation<\/p>\n<p class=\"p3\">Repetitive results description<\/p>\n<p class=\"p3\">Professional thesis editing reduces exposure to these critiques.<\/p>\n<p class=\"p3\">Editing improves articulation, not research substance.<\/p>\n<hr \/>\n<h2><b>Formatting and Presentation in Biomedical Theses<\/b><\/h2>\n<p class=\"p3\">Computational biology theses often include:<\/p>\n<p class=\"p3\">Extensive appendices<\/p>\n<p class=\"p3\">Code snippets<\/p>\n<p class=\"p3\">Flow diagrams<\/p>\n<p class=\"p3\">Large datasets<\/p>\n<p class=\"p3\">Supplementary figures<\/p>\n<p class=\"p3\">Editors verify formatting consistency and logical placement.
